M&M Transport reported a data breach to the Attorney General of Maine, revealing that sensitive personal information in its systems may have been accessed. The breach was discovered on June 30, 2024, when unauthorized third parties deployed malicious software to access the company’s systems. M&M Transport initiated an investigation to assess the incident’s impact and the extent of the compromised data.
The investigation determined that the breach occurred on June 4, 2024. The compromised data includes names, Social Security numbers, dates of birth, driver’s license information, passport numbers, and I-9 information. M&M Transport has conducted a review to identify which individuals were affected and the specific information that was exposed.
On July 31, 2024, M&M Transport began notifying affected individuals through data breach notification letters. The company is offering a list of the impacted information and providing 12 months of complimentary credit monitoring services to those affected. M&M Transport, headquartered in West Bridgewater, Massachusetts, is a transportation service provider with a nationwide presence. Founded in 1990, the company operates multiple terminals and services a broad customer base with a modern fleet of over 550 tractors and 3,000 trailers.
